Advantages of hydraulic retarder

The hydraulic retarder is a vehicle auxiliary braking device with many advantages, the main advantages of which will be described in detail below.

1. improve driving safety

The hydraulic retarder generates a slow and uniform deceleration force through the hydraulic device, which effectively helps the vehicle to decelerate, thereby greatly improving driving safety. Compared with traditional mechanical brakes, the hydraulic retarder can better maintain the stability of the vehicle under high-speed driving and emergency braking, and reduce the risk of accidents such as side slip and rear-end collision.

2. reduce wear and maintenance costs

Since the deceleration force generated by the hydraulic retarder is uniform, the wear on the vehicle tires, braking system and other components is greatly reduced, and the service life of the vehicle is extended. At the same time, the maintenance cost of the hydraulic retarder is relatively low, and its internal liquid can be checked and replaced regularly, without complicated mechanical maintenance.

3. improve driving comfort

The impact force generated by the hydraulic retarder during the deceleration process is small, and the driver can feel a more stable deceleration process, which improves the driving comfort. In addition, the hydraulic retarder can also be controlled according to the needs of the driver to achieve the deceleration needs of different scenarios.

4. energy saving and environmental protection

The hydraulic retarder decelerates through liquid without additional energy input, so it has the advantages of energy saving and environmental protection. Compared with the traditional brake system, the hydraulic retarder does not generate a lot of heat and noise during use, reducing energy consumption and environmental pollution.

5. for a variety of models and scenarios

The hydraulic retarder is suitable for a variety of models and scenarios, including passenger cars, trucks, and special vehicles. Whether on urban roads, highways or mountain roads, hydraulic retarders can provide good braking performance to meet the driving needs of different scenarios.
